How to turn Google Play Protect on or off

  1. Open the Google Play Store app .
  2. At the top right, tap the profile icon.
  3. Tap Play Protect. Settings.
  4. Turn Scan apps with Play Protect on or off.

What is play protect certification?

If your device isn’t Play Protect certified, Google doesn’t have a record of the Android compatibility test results. Keep in mind that: Devices that aren’t Play Protect certified may not be secure. Devices that aren’t Play Protect certified may not get Android system updates or app updates.

What is play Protect on Android?

Every day, Google Play Protect automatically scans all of the apps on Android phones and works to prevent the installation of harmful apps, making it the most widely deployed mobile threat protection service in the world.

What is an uncertified Android device?

Uncertified devices have not passed Google’s Android compatibility test to ensure they meet Google’s quality and security standards. Some newer Android devices are temporarily uncertified when they’re first released, but are later certified once the process is complete.

Is my phone Google Play certified?

Tap your profile picture in the top-right. Tap Settings. Tap About to expand the section. Look at the Play Protection certification.

Can you bypass Google FRP?

FRP on any Android device is automatically enabled once a Google account is logged in to a device. The only way to get rid of it is by removing the account from the device into which it has been synced.
